The Access to HE Diploma (Health) is a nationally recognised qualification with common requirements relating to the description of student achievement. The course is a credit-based, graded qualification and requirements relate to both the award of credit and to the award of grades. In order to obtain the full Access Diploma you will need to obtain 15 credits at level 2; these credits are obtained from common core units. In addition you will need to obtain 45 credits at level 3 from humanities/social science units. Attendance: Two days a week (Tuesday and Wednesday). These will be 9.15am til 3.30pm both days.
